news 2026/4/18 15:35:14

如何快速获取阿里云盘Refresh Token:扫码神器完整指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
如何快速获取阿里云盘Refresh Token:扫码神器完整指南

如何快速获取阿里云盘Refresh Token:扫码神器完整指南

【免费下载链接】aliyundriver-refresh-tokenQR Code扫码获取阿里云盘refresh token For Web项目地址: https://gitcode.com/gh_mirrors/al/aliyundriver-refresh-token

想轻松获取阿里云盘的Refresh Token吗?本文将为你介绍一款免费开源的阿里云盘Refresh Token扫码工具,无需复杂操作,通过简单几步即可完成令牌获取,让你的云盘管理效率飙升!

什么是阿里云盘Refresh Token?

Refresh Token是阿里云盘API授权的核心凭证,有了它你可以:

  • 实现云盘文件的自动化管理
  • 对接第三方工具实现多端同步
  • 开发个性化云盘应用(需遵守官方规范)

而这款工具通过QR Code扫码方式,让获取过程变得像登录微信一样简单!

两种部署方式任你选

一键部署到Vercel(推荐新手)

无需服务器,零成本快速使用:

  1. 准备好你的Vercel账号
  2. 授权并完成项目部署
  3. 等待2分钟自动构建完成

整个过程无需修改任何配置,系统会自动完成环境搭建,即使是技术新手也能轻松上手。

本地开发模式(适合开发者)

如果你需要二次开发或本地测试,可以通过以下步骤运行:

# 克隆项目代码 git clone https://gitcode.com/gh_mirrors/al/aliyundriver-refresh-token # 安装依赖包 cd aliyundriver-refresh-token && npm install # 启动开发服务器 npm run serve

开发服务器默认运行在本地端口4000,访问后即可看到简洁的操作界面。

核心功能使用指南

生成登录二维码

调用接口/api/generate

这是获取令牌的第一步,通过访问API生成专属二维码:

GET /api/generate?img=true

参数说明:

  • img=true:返回Base64格式二维码图片(默认)
  • img=false:返回二维码内容文本(需自行绘制)

返回结果包含三个关键参数:

  • tck:后续查询状态的凭证
  • codeContent:二维码图片数据或文本内容

查询扫码状态

调用接口/api/state-query

生成二维码后,需要轮询此接口查询扫码状态:

GET /api/state-query?t=xxx&ck=xxx

状态说明:

  • NEW:等待扫码(请用阿里云盘APP扫描)
  • SCANED:已扫码,等待手机确认
  • CONFIRMED:确认成功!bizExt字段包含解码后的Refresh Token
  • EXPIRED:二维码过期(需重新生成)
  • CANCELED:用户取消授权

建议每2秒查询一次状态,避免请求过于频繁影响用户体验。

附加实用功能

每日签到接口

通过获取的Refresh Token,还可以调用签到接口:

GET /api/sign?refreshToken=你的令牌

返回示例:

本月累计签到5天 第5天奖励领取成功: 获得500MB存储空间

签到功能源码位于api/sign.ts文件,方便开发者理解和定制。

链接有效性检查

验证阿里云盘分享链接是否有效:

GET /api/check_link?link=https://www.aliyundrive.com/s/xxx

返回code=200表示链接有效,可用于批量检查分享资源状态。

项目结构速览

核心功能模块分布清晰:

  • API接口实现:api/目录
    • 二维码生成:generate.ts
    • 状态查询:state-query.ts
    • 签到功能:sign.ts
  • 本地服务:serve/目录
    • 开发服务器配置:local-serve.ts

重要注意事项

  1. 安全提示:Refresh Token等同于登录凭证,请妥善保管,切勿分享给他人!
  2. 使用规范:本工具仅用于学习交流,禁止用于非法用途
  3. 版本更新:功能可能随阿里云盘API变化而调整,请关注项目更新

常见问题解答

Q: 二维码有效期多久?A: 默认5分钟,过期后需重新生成

Q: 部署后访问提示404?A: 检查构建日志,确保没有编译错误

Q: 可以集成到我的应用中吗?A: 可以,但需遵守MIT许可证并注明来源

许可证信息

本项目采用MIT开源许可协议,完整许可文本见LICENSE文件。

通过这款工具,你已经掌握了阿里云盘API授权的关键钥匙!无论是个人使用还是开发集成,都能让云盘操作变得前所未有的高效。如果觉得有用,欢迎给项目点个Star支持!

【免费下载链接】aliyundriver-refresh-tokenQR Code扫码获取阿里云盘refresh token For Web项目地址: https://gitcode.com/gh_mirrors/al/aliyundriver-refresh-token

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 9:18:51

联想拯救者工具箱:轻量化硬件控制新体验

联想拯救者工具箱:轻量化硬件控制新体验 【免费下载链接】LenovoLegionToolkit Lightweight Lenovo Vantage and Hotkeys replacement for Lenovo Legion laptops. 项目地址: https://gitcode.com/gh_mirrors/le/LenovoLegionToolkit 还在为官方软件占用系统…

作者头像 李华
网站建设 2026/4/17 19:31:29

decimal.js 高精度数值计算库完整实战指南

decimal.js 高精度数值计算库完整实战指南 【免费下载链接】decimal.js An arbitrary-precision Decimal type for JavaScript 项目地址: https://gitcode.com/gh_mirrors/de/decimal.js 项目简介 decimal.js 是一款专为 JavaScript 设计的任意精度十进制数计算库&…

作者头像 李华
网站建设 2026/4/17 10:09:39

LosslessCut终极指南:零基础掌握无损视频剪辑技术

还在为视频剪辑导致的画质下降而烦恼吗?LosslessCut这款革命性的无损视频处理工具,让每个人都能在不重新编码的情况下完成专业级的视频编辑任务。无论是从长视频中提取精彩片段,还是为不同设备优化视频格式,这款被誉为"音视频…

作者头像 李华
网站建设 2026/4/18 3:27:51

OpenBoardView:完全免费的.brd电路板文件终极查看方案

OpenBoardView:完全免费的.brd电路板文件终极查看方案 【免费下载链接】OpenBoardView View .brd files 项目地址: https://gitcode.com/gh_mirrors/op/OpenBoardView 在电子设计领域,工程师们常常面临一个现实问题:如何在没有昂贵专业…

作者头像 李华
网站建设 2026/4/18 3:29:26

Draw.io Mermaid插件终极指南:3步实现文本可视化高效创作

Draw.io Mermaid插件终极指南:3步实现文本可视化高效创作 【免费下载链接】drawio_mermaid_plugin Mermaid plugin for drawio desktop 项目地址: https://gitcode.com/gh_mirrors/dr/drawio_mermaid_plugin 还在为手动绘制复杂图表而烦恼吗?Draw…

作者头像 李华
网站建设 2026/4/18 3:27:30

Xcode调试救星:iOS设备支持文件快速部署全攻略

Xcode调试救星:iOS设备支持文件快速部署全攻略 【免费下载链接】iOSDeviceSupport All versions of iOS Device Support 项目地址: https://gitcode.com/gh_mirrors/ios/iOSDeviceSupport 问题诊断室:识别调试失败的典型症状 当你连接iOS设备到X…

作者头像 李华